1943 Lago Lake Maggiore Verbano Italy Switzerland Plant - ORIGINAL EUR1 XGTB9 This is an original 1909This is an original 1943 photogravure of plants on the banks of Lake Maggiore (Lago Maggiore) that borders Italy and Switzerland. The lake was mentioned in Hemingway's "A Farewell to Arms" when the two lovers are trying to cross the border in a rowboat. The photographer of the image is Dr. Martin Hrlimann.
